- Clifford’s Centra in Cork city, Ireland, has been identified as the shop that sold the winning €250 million EuroMillions jackpot ticket.
- Shop owner Ted Clifford expressed excitement, initially thinking the news was a prank, and highlighted his shop's previous success in selling winning tickets.
- This €250 million prize is the largest ever EuroMillions win in Ireland and marks the 18th Irish jackpot winner.
- The winner has already contacted the National Lottery, which will provide support for managing the significant sum.
- Ted Clifford plans to use the €25,000 prize money awarded to the shop to host a 'big celebration' for his staff.
